Summary
Jean-louis Quéguiner is a seasoned technology founder and leader, currently building AI-driven audio infrastructure as Founder & CEO of Gladia, which raised $14M in Series A in 2024 to accelerate speech AI solutions for businesses. With 11 years of experience across data, AI, and quantum computing, he blends hands-on software engineering with strategic product leadership, most recently as OVHcloud Group VP & Fellow - Research & Innovation and earlier as Head of Data, AI and Quantum Computing. His entrepreneurial track includes founding Madgency, delivering sport-management software, and serving as CTO Data at Auchan, reflecting a proven ability to turn complex data challenges into scalable platforms. He began coding at age 10 and holds MSc-level engineering training from Arts et Métiers and ÉTS, underscoring a rigorous technical foundation. Based in New York, he operates at the crossroads of AI, audio technology, and enterprise-scale infrastructure to empower faster, more accurate, and innovative communications globally.
